Army foils drug smuggling attempt from Syria


(MENAFN- Jordan News Agency) Amman, Oct.19 (Petra) -- The Northern Military Zone, in coordination with the Anti-Narcotics Department and the Public Security Department, late Wednesday foiled a smuggling attempt by two people, one armed, who tried to cross the border from Syria into the Kingdom, a military official said Thursday .

The official explained that the rules of engagement were applied, forcing the two infiltrators to flee back to Syria. After searching the area, the security personnel reportedly found 180,000 Captagon pills, and referred them to the concerned authorities, he added.
